#69bafd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#69bafd is composed of 41.2% red, 72.9%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 207.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 70.2%. #69bafd color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ffff with #0075fb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#69bafd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#69bafd has RGB values of R:105, G:186,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 6929149.

Shades and Tints of #69bafd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000305 is the darkest color, while #f1f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#69bafd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b3b7 is the less saturated color, while #69bafd is the most saturated one.
